Calgary Stampeders News Release
(Calgary) â The Calgary Stampeders are pleased to announce that they added Ashlyn Smith Clark to the Stampeder family.
On Wednesday, October 13th this morning Stampeder Linebacker Brian Clark and his wife Shannon delivered a baby girl named Ashlyn Smith Clark at Foothills Hospital. Ashlyn weighed in at 6 pounds, 8 ounces, while stretching to 18 1/2 inches in length.
